Forename Mirei

All over the world, Mirei (ميري Iran Iraq Sudan Egypt Syria, Mirei Japan United States Myanmar Iran Australia, Мирей Russia Kazakhstan Kyrgyzstan Ukraine) is quite a rare mostly female, but infrequently masculine given name. The given name Mirei is habitual in Sudan, where it is quite a rare primarily feminine, but scarcely masculine name, Libya, where it is quite a rare dominantly feminine, but seldom male name, and Syria, where it is quite a rare female name. Measured by absolute frequency, it is the most numerous in Sudan, Egypt, and Iraq. More frequently, Mirei is the last name as well as the forename.
